Jeez I'd love to have the money to buy an Italian made Flail mower, but they start at about AUD$6000 and if you consider that the AUD$ and the US$ are almost on par that's a lot. The best and I mean the very best price I can get on a second hand Silvan is $2500.

So the comparison between the two I mentioned is $500 with just the name of the website (dissanddat.com.au) putting me off, anyhow they are both OK on paper with the Hayes unit being slightly more heavy duty. It has a 70HP gearbox and the other only 50HP. Both seems to have 6mm steel sides, the Hayes doesn't say bit it looks like 6mm, and the hitch on the Hayes looks better.

Stephan,

I would much rather see you purchase the used Silvan for the piece of mind
as these things scare me and I am 33 year owner of flail mowers.


They are easy enough to repair or have repaired.


just remember the paint is nice and shiny and good at
covering poor engineering and design and material quality
and metal thickness.

if you own a micrometer that will tell you plenty.

The other issue is te lack fo steel in threar to prevent the
mower from twisting and racking.
